EXCEL VBA中 if条件语句的介绍

 时间:2026-02-13 21:07:34

1、'单行写法  (后面将省去首尾两句)

Sub 条件语句()

If a < 20 Then [b2] = "good"

end sub

2、'多行写法

If a < 20 Then

[b2] = "shit"

End If

'if esle

If a < 20 Then

[b2] = "yes"

Else

[b2] = "no"

End If

3、'多条件判断

If a < 20 Then

 [b2] = "very bad"

ElseIf a < 40 Then

 [b2] = "bad"

ElseIf a < 60 Then

 [b2] = "normal"

Else

 [b2] = "good"

End If

4、单行写法if后,执行多条语句,用冒号隔开

If a < 20 Then [b2] = "good": [b3] = "yes"

'单行if else

If a < 20 Then [b2] = "aa" Else [b2] = "bb"

5、总结:

if 条件1 then

  条件1成立时运行的语句

elseif 条件2 then

 条件2成立运行的语句

....

else

  所有条件都不成立时运行的语句

end if

  • EXCEL对话操作——msgbox
  • 怎样用VBA对选区数据按拼音排序并区分大小写?
  • vba中全局变量和局部变量的重要解析
  • 怎样使用VBA批量填充单元格数据?
  • 怎样使用VBA根据最大值和最小值求所有数据之和?
  • 热门搜索
    红豆薏米水怎么煮去湿气 王者荣耀英雄大全 家常红烧排骨 年轻人血压高怎么办 香菇油菜的家常做法 dnf炽星魔盒怎么开 金夫人婚纱摄影怎么样 电视墙背景墙大全 失眠多梦的治疗方法 图片大全